Block 688,383

Block Hash

04f6d8535dc7cb6a8f39789b035b2e6e26a2c0d6d97c58f14e551746204866c0

Previous Block Hash

22dc6b6ffd03a23b16b94a7625e2f2f511d726e377b6d60a953a6f12c267047a

Mined

Transactions

3

Difficulty

39.61 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.00452 PEPE
1 input, 2 outputs
63,268.171 PEPE
1 input, 2 outputs
120.40458663 PEPE